The Pitfalls of Over-Specificity: A Hidden Enemy of Prompt Engineering
As AI model developers, we've all been guilty of crafting prompts that are too specific, too narrow, and too predictable. Sounds harmless, but the unintended consequences can be disastrous. Let's dive into the common pitfalls of over-specificity in prompt engineering and explore strategies to avoid them.
Case Study: "Write a poem about a cat in Tokyo"
At first glance, this prompt seems innocuous. However, it suffers from a fundamental flaw: it's too specific. By mentioning a cat and Tokyo, we're limiting the model's ability to generate novel and creative responses. The model will likely rely on pre-existing knowledge about cats and Tokyo, producing a predictable and uninspired poem.
The Hidden Enemy: Over-Reliance on Pre-Trained Knowledge
When prompts are too specific, they force the model to over-rely on pre-trained knowledge rather than using its ability to reason and generate novel responses. This over-reliance leads to predictable and stale output, which defeats the purpose of AI-generated content.
Fixing the Pitfalls: Strategies for More Effective Prompt Engineering
- Broaden your scope: Instead of focusing on a specific topic, try to identify key themes or concepts that you want the model to address. For example, "Explore the intersection of nature and urbanization in a fictional city."
- Use ambiguous or open-ended words: Include words or phrases that allow the model to infer meaning, rather than relying on pre-trained knowledge. For instance, "Describe a city that's both vibrant and eerie."
- Ask open-ended questions: Instead of asking yes/no questions, use open-ended queries that encourage the model to generate creative responses. For example, "What's the most fascinating city on Earth?"
